The renewed agreement with Greymoor Provisions sets royalties at 6.5% of net sales, with a marketing levy of 1.5% remitted quarterly. Initial fees for the three new Halbrook-area territories are payable on signing, amortized over the ten-year term. Buildout costs remain the franchisee's obligation, though we extend fixture financing at preferred rates. Compliance audits move to an annual cadence. Branch managers should model these terms into next year's targets; the strategic intent is summarized immediately below.

board note of fahag-tajop: The eastern region missed its Julix quota by 44.0 percent last quarter. Ralionax Holdings plans to lower the Druath list price by 61.8 percent in March. The board signed off on a budget of $295.0 million for Project Gilath. The renewal with Ruswynix Systems closes at $274.5 million a year, 17.0 percent above the last contract.

Ticket: Staging env misconfigured for Siftgate bloom filter

The bloom layer in front of the Pellet KV store is rejecting all lookups in staging because the env file was copied from the dev template without credentials. False-positive tuning values are fine; only the auth line is missing. To unblock the weekly demo, the Pellet admission secret must be set on the following line.

env line for yaguf-fajop: LEDGER_TOKEN13=fb08984397349

Design excerpt — Splayview large-file diff viewer. For files above the streaming threshold, Splayview switches from full in-memory Myers diff to a chunked anchor-based algorithm, trading precision for bounded memory. The release manager should note that chunk size, anchor density, and render window are shipped as config, not code, so a point release can retune them without a rebuild. Regressions in diff quality on the Harrowell repo usually mean anchors are too sparse. Shipping defaults follow.

constants for tafog-kahag:
RATE_LIMITS = {
    "sorir": 697,
    "oliox": 683,
    "holax": 176,
    "casox": 60,
    "pelius": 382,
}

Hey Marit,

Handing over the report builder stuff before I'm out. Main thing plugin authors keep hitting: sorting in Tallygrid is stable only if they pass an explicit tiebreaker column — otherwise row order can shuffle between runs, and people file bugs. Docs now say to always append the primary key as the final sort. To verify ordering yourself, query the reporting replica via the connection string below.

primary connection of tajeg-tajop = postgresql://julax_svc:DI@db-e7f3.kelvidyn.corp:5432/rusdor